A security vulnerability has been detected in H3C Magic B0 up to 100R002. The affected element is the function SetMobileAPInfoById of the file /goform/aspForm. Such manipulation of the argument param leads to stack-based buffer overflow. The attack may be performed from remote. The exploit has been disclosed publicly and may be used. The vendor was contacted early about this disclosure but did not respond in any way.
